How do you make sure your Mac is backed up?

Make sure your Mac Pro is on the same Wi-Fi network as your external storage device, or connect the storage device to your Mac Pro. Open System Preferences, click Time Machine, then select Back Up Automatically. Select the drive you want to use for backup, and you’re all set.

Also, How long should a Mac backup take?

Preparing backup shouldn’t take more than 5 or 10 minutes if your Mac is new and you barely have anything on it.

Can Apple Time Machine backup to iCloud? While iCloud Drive lets you upload documents to Apple’s servers for online access. But no matter how much iCloud storage you have, you can’t tell Time Machine to back up your Mac to iCloud Drive. In fact, unlike on iPhone or iPad, Apple offers no official way to back up your Mac to iCloud.

Can I put my Mac to sleep while backing up?

Back up your Mac while asleep

If your Mac supports Power Nap it can perform Time Machine backups while it’s asleep or the lid is shut. It just needs to be plugged into the mains. You can find Power Nap in System Preferences > Energy Saver.

Does Time Machine slow down Mac?

Time Machine is designed so that it doesn’t interfere with the regular operation of your computer. If your Mac is busy, hot, or the battery is running low (Mac notebooks only), Time Machine slows until your Mac is idle, cool, or charged.

Why is my Time Machine backup so big?

2 Answers. Time Machine is using differential backups. That means your first backup is a complete backup which is same size with your drive. Starting from the second one backup will include changed files since last backup.

Does Apple still sell Time Machine?

If so, you should consider replacing it since Apple discontinued the product in 2018 and provided the last significant upgrade to the Time Capsule in 2012. … The AirPort Time Capsule was a unique product since it was both a Wi-Fi router and a network attached storage (NAS) device.

Where did all my photos go on my Mac?

By default, the System Photo Library is located in the Pictures folder on your Mac. You can also create additional photo libraries on your Mac and on other storage devices. You should always use the Photos app to access the photos in a Photos library.

Can I shut down my Mac while Time Machine is backing up?

Answer: A: it does not matter. so long as you shut down properly (from the shut down menu and not by holding the power button) TM will stop cleanly and resume the interrupted backup when you power up the computer.
